ba8fdf1a8c fix: MCP init tool creates .beads in current directory
Critical bug: MCP init tool reported success but didn't create .beads
directory. It was using --db flag which tells bd to use an existing
database elsewhere instead of creating a new one.

Root cause:
- bd_client.init() was calling _global_flags() which adds --db flag
- bd init --db <path> uses existing db instead of creating new one
- Result: init appeared to succeed but created nothing

Fix:
- Remove _global_flags() from init command
- Only pass --actor flag (safe for init)
- Do NOT pass --db flag to init (defeats the purpose)
- Add explicit comment explaining why

Testing:
- Added test_init_creates_beads_directory() integration test
- Verifies .beads directory is created in current working directory
- Verifies database file has correct prefix
- All 91 tests pass

This was causing silent failures where agents thought they initialized
bd but the .beads directory was never created.

800ed300a6 fix: MCP server bd executable path resolution
Fixes issue where MCP tools failed with "bd executable not found"
when BEADS_PATH was set to command name instead of absolute path.

Changes:
- Remove BEADS_PATH=bd from plugin.json (use auto-detection)
- Enhance config validator to resolve command names via PATH
- Add comprehensive config validation tests (11 new tests)

The validator now accepts both:
  - Absolute paths: /usr/local/bin/bd
  - Command names: bd (resolved via shutil.which)

This makes the MCP server more robust and user-friendly while
maintaining backward compatibility.

All 90 tests pass.
